The thriving landscape of investments offers investors a wide range of options to distribute their capital. Among these, S&P 500 Sector ETFs have emerged as prominent choices for achieving exposure to specific sectors. These ETFs mirror the performance of companies within a particular sector, allowing investors to hone in on their capital deployment based on sectoral growth prospects.
By evaluating the performance of various S&P 500 Sector ETFs, investors can gain valuable insights into current market trends and identify potential investment opportunities.
- Understanding the results of different sectors allows investors to adjust allocations their portfolios effectively.
- Historical performance data can serve as a indicator for future trends.
- Comparative analysis of sector ETFs can expose the strengths and weaknesses of different industries.
Additionally, factors such as economic conditions, governmental changes, and niche automated trading platform developments can substantially impact the performance of S&P 500 Sector ETFs.
